Output 46261760067a2e22004f687ab7de4a48fe9968c558af75cc9ba3c34aa05dfe78:1

value
26656500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1900eeaa129b0405a9718eb79f73f6a79be0392 OP_EQUALVERIFY OP_CHECKSIG
address
1HBsBJH8HxFZjdEFGHDqTiFupBcNCoNb1e
transaction
46261760067a2e22004f687ab7de4a48fe9968c558af75cc9ba3c34aa05dfe78
spent
true